Autumn programme for Echo Echo Dance

Echo Echo Dance Theatre Company will begin a new autumn programme of classes and

performances later this month.

The award-winning dance company is now based in purpose-built independent studios in a beautifully refurbished space on the city’s historic Walls at Hangman’s Bastion on Magazine Street.

The company is inviting new and returning participants of all ages and abilities to the autumn series including youth dance, children’s classes, parent and toddlers, and weekday morning and evening classes for adults.

Echo Echo Company Manager, Ailbe Beirne, told the Sentinel that classes for kids have been popular through the summer, “The feedback we’ve received this year really shows the positive impact of taking part. Parents particularly have let us know how good Echo Echo classes were for building self-confidence among their children and we’ve received some genuinely amazing success stories. Numbers for kids classes always fill up quickly so we are advising parents to book in advance this term.

“Also for adults, dance and creativity are perfect ways to develop wellbeing and improve fitness in a really creative atmosphere. There are excellent new facilities at Echo Echo so it’s a great opportunity to join in the work we are doing here,” he added.

In addition to regular dance classes, Echo Echo hosts a growing range of dance and movement activities including Wing Tsjun with Karen Cassidy, Aikido with Aureli Osle, Baby Massage with Silvia Levi, Walled City Salsa, and Body Wisdom movement for over-50’s.

With the city set to participate in Culture Night next Friday, September 19 and inviting anyone in the city to have a look around its new building, “Echo Echo is joining in the Culture Night programme and we have a packed programme of events for CultureTech Festival that day and a special Echo Echo Ensemble performance in the evening – so we are encouraging anyone who hasn’t been yet to call in for a look.”
